FAT32 Format

The FAT32 format is one of the oldest and most widely supported formats. It’s compatible with virtually all devices, including Windows, Mac, and Linux computers, as well as many gaming consoles and other devices. However, it has some significant limitations. FAT32 has a maximum file size limit of 4GB, which means you can’t store files larger than that on a FAT32-formatted USB drive. Additionally, FAT32 doesn’t support file compression, encryption, or access control, making it less secure than other formats.

How do I format a USB drive to NTFS?

Formatting a USB drive to NTFS is a relatively straightforward process that can be done using the built-in tools in Windows. To format a USB drive to NTFS, first connect the drive to your computer and open the Disk Management tool. You can do this by pressing the Windows key + R and typing “diskmgmt.msc” in the run dialog box. Once you have opened the Disk Management tool, locate the USB drive in the list of available disks and right-click on it to select the “Format” option. In the format dialog box, select NTFS as the file system and choose the allocation unit size and volume label as desired.

Once you have selected the format options, click “OK” to begin the formatting process. The formatting process should only take a few seconds to complete, depending on the size of the drive. Once the formatting is complete, the drive will be ready to use with NTFS formatting. Note that formatting a drive will erase all data on the drive, so make sure to back up any important files before formatting. Additionally, some devices may require additional configuration or setup to work with NTFS-formatted drives, so be sure to check the device documentation for specific instructions.

What are the limitations of using FAT32 formatting?

The main limitations of using FAT32 formatting are its limited file size and storage capacity support. FAT32 has a maximum file size limit of 4GB, which can be a problem if you need to store large files or collections of files. Additionally, FAT32 has a limited storage capacity of 2TB, which can be a problem if you need to store large amounts of data. Another limitation of FAT32 is its lack of advanced security features, such as file encryption and access control, which can make it less secure than other formats like NTFS.
